Principal's Note

 

May 17, 2013

Dear Families,

Tuesday is the district’s budget vote! Be sure to get to the high school between the hours of 7 a.m. and 9 p.m. to make your voice heard. On the district’s website you can read all about the proposed budget and also the three candidates running for the two School Board seats. While our Glenmont students may be too young to vote in these elections, they will be able to cast their vote for a new snack to be served in the cafeteria as a part of the “Kids Vote Too” program, so be sure to bring them along when you cast your ballot.

Congratulations to our fabulous fourth and fifth graders for making such beautiful music together this past Wednesday evening! Special thanks to Mrs. Seebode, Ms. Vitale, and Mr. O’Connell for guiding our children to develop a love of music.

Our 5th graders visited the middle school today and they have their Pit Party celebration this evening. It’s hard to believe they will be leaving us soon, but they are ready to fly.

Thanks to your efforts, Glenmont School was one of the top schools in earning points with the Price Chopper Tools for School program, and so we won a $250 Price Chopper gift card as well as a basket of school supplies. The PTA will be using the gift card to help with field day purchases, and our faculty will be using the basket of school supplies. We were able to redeem our points for new recess games and materials such as balls, frisbees, jump ropes, chalk and more. In addition, we were able to order some headphones and also some music materials. Thank you to all of you who have been earning points for us all year!

Next week everyone is invited to our Art Show on Thursday, May 23 from 4:30-7 p.m. Come to see a piece of art by every student in the school, and enjoy some Panera snacks our PTA has arranged for us to enjoy. Also on Thursday, our fourth graders will be taking the NYS Science performance test. The written portion of the NYS science test will follow for them on Monday, June 3.
